Thank you for providing me this info. I was able to locate the account. Currently I am unable to get any deeper reads due to there being no communication coming from or to the modem currently. I was, however, able to confirm the equipment itself seems to be operational but it is not transmitting. Normally this can happen because of heavy cloud coverage or movement of the dish out of position which leaves us with two options. The first would be for you to wait until the weather is fully clear and I have you locate the updated state code unless the service resumes normal function. This will help us figure out our next steps. The second would be to call our support line immediately and have a technician sent out. I do want to warn that the phone reps may also require clear weather before sending a tech out. I know this is not the most convenient solution but satellite technology is very susceptible to poor weather and these things can happen.  I apologize for any inconvenience this may be causing you. - Damian

That state code is just the FAP code. What other errors do you see?

About the weather: weather at the ground station location can also affect the signal.

Oh, that's because they don't support Web Acceleration anymore. That used to be for non-secure sites (http), but now most of the Web is secure (https), and so they did away with Web Acceleration.
